Babybiane Imedia 7 sachets is a food for special medical purposes from the French manufacturer PiLeJe. It is formulated for the nutritional needs of infants from birth and young children up to four years of age in cases of acute gastroenteritis or antibiotic-associated diarrhoea.
Each sachet provides 10 billion CFU of the precisely identified microbiotic strain Lacticaseibacillus rhamnosus GG LA801, previously known as Lactobacillus rhamnosus GG LA801. The product must be used under medical supervision and does not replace oral rehydration or paediatric assessment.

Pharmacist’s advice
Preventing dehydration is the priority when an infant has diarrhoea. Babybiane Imedia does not replace an appropriately prepared oral rehydration solution. Offer the solution frequently in small amounts according to paediatric advice. Do not mix the sachet with hot milk, food or drinks because high temperatures may damage the microbiotic strain. When the child is receiving an antibiotic, confirm the timing of administration with a paediatrician or pharmacist.
Seek medical advice promptly for frequent watery stools, repeated vomiting, blood in the stool, high fever, marked drowsiness, dry mouth, absence of tears, a sunken fontanelle or substantially fewer wet nappies. Ljubica Barbulović, Master of Pharmacy |
Directions and important information
Directions: dissolve the contents of one sachet in a bottle or glass containing approximately 150–200 ml of a cold or lukewarm drink, or mix it with food suitable for the child’s age. It may also be mixed with a correctly prepared oral rehydration solution when advised by a healthcare professional.
Timing: administer once daily, preferably before a meal.
Recommended course: the current manufacturer’s directions state seven days. Some local packs may state 5–7 days for acute enteritis or 7–14 days for antibiotic-associated diarrhoea. Follow the specific pack declaration and paediatric advice.
Age: formulated for infants from birth and young children up to four years of age.
Pack size: seven sachets of 1.5 g.
Net weight: 10.5 g.
Amount per sachet: 10 × 109 CFU of Lacticaseibacillus rhamnosus GG LA801.
Medical supervision: Babybiane Imedia must be used under medical supervision. It is not suitable as the sole source of nutrition and is not intended for parenteral use.
Acute diarrhoea: contact a paediatrician when an infant or young child develops several watery stools within a short period, particularly when accompanied by vomiting or fever.
Feeding: breastfeeding is generally continued unless the paediatrician advises otherwise. Do not independently introduce restrictive diets, sugary juices or homemade solutions with an unverified salt-to-sugar ratio.
Antibiotic treatment: the product does not replace an antibiotic when antibiotic treatment is medically indicated. Never discontinue or alter prescribed treatment without medical advice.
Hypersensitivity: do not give the product to a child who is hypersensitive to any ingredient.
Storage: store in the original packaging in a cool, dry place protected from moisture and heat.
Frequently asked questions
Is Babybiane Imedia a standard probiotic supplement?
No. It is a food for special medical purposes formulated for specific nutritional needs during acute or antibiotic-associated diarrhoea and must be used under medical supervision.
Which strain does it contain?
It contains Lacticaseibacillus rhamnosus GG LA801, previously known as Lactobacillus rhamnosus GG LA801.
How many CFU are provided per sachet?
Each sachet provides 10 billion CFU.
Can it be used from birth?
Yes. The current declaration covers children from birth to four years of age, but only under medical supervision.
Can it be mixed with hot milk?
No. Mix the powder with a cold or lukewarm drink or food. High temperatures may reduce the viability of the microbiotic strain.
Does it replace an oral rehydration solution?
No. Fluid and electrolyte replacement is the priority during diarrhoea. Babybiane Imedia has a different role.
How long does one pack last?
At one sachet daily, the pack lasts for seven days.
When is urgent medical advice required?
For blood in the stool, repeated vomiting, high fever, pronounced drowsiness, inability to drink, a sunken fontanelle, dry mouth or markedly reduced urination.
Ingredients: maltodextrin; freeze-dried culture of Lacticaseibacillus rhamnosus GG LA801.
According to the local declaration: free from lactose, gluten, preservatives and artificial colours. Always check the specific pack before use.
| Ingredient / nutritional value | Per sachet |
|---|---|
| Lacticaseibacillus rhamnosus GG LA801 | 10 × 109 CFU |
| Energy | 25 kJ / 6 kcal |
| Carbohydrate | 1.4 g |
| Of which sugars | less than 0.5 g |
| Protein | less than 0.5 g |
| Salt | less than 0.01 g |
